Pharmacist's Verdict
AZO Urinary Pain Relief is an excellent, fast-acting medication for the pain and burning of a urinary tract infection (UTI), but it is not an antibiotic and will not cure the infection.

Pros & Cons
Pros
- Provides fast relief from urinary pain, burning, and urgency, often within an hour.
- Specifically targets the urinary tract for localized pain relief.
- Available over-the-counter without a prescription.
- Contains the maximum strength dose allowed for non-prescription use.
Cons
- Does NOT treat the underlying infection; you must see a doctor for an antibiotic.
- Will turn urine and sometimes tears a bright reddish-orange color, which can permanently stain clothing and contact lenses.
- Should not be used for more than two days.
- May cause stomach upset, so it's best taken with food or after a meal.
- Can interfere with lab tests that use urine samples.
